Embodiment 1

[0018] Embodiment 1: the preparation method of a kind of silk functional textile of the present invention, it adopts following steps:

[0019] A) With 1 part of textiles and 10 parts of solution in parts by mass, put the cocoon-coated non-woven fabric into an acidic aqueous solution with a pH value of 5, and press 1 part of cocoon-coated non-woven fabric, ethylene glycol diglycidol Add alanine at the ratio of 0.2 part of ethyl ether and 0.1 part of alanine, stir, and react at 35°C for 0.5 hours;

[0020] B) According to the mass parts of step A), take 1 part of sodium cyanoborohydride and 1 part of β-cyclodextrin monoaldehyde, put them into the solution of step A), react at 55 °C for 5 hours, and wait for the reaction to complete Finally, adjust the pH to neutral, and wash the product;

Abstract

The invention relates to a preparation method of a natural silk functional textile. The preparation method comprises the following steps: A) adding a cocoon stripping nonwoven fabric, ethylene glycol diglycidyl diethyl ether and alanine into alanine, and stirring for reacting; B) putting sodium cyanoborohydride and beta-cyclodextrin monoaldehyde into a solution obtained in the step A) to react, after the reaction is completed, adjusting the pH value to be neutral, and cleaning the obtained product; C) putting the product obtained by reaction into a beta-cinnamic acid solution, carrying out heat preservation at a temperature of 45-55 DEG C, and taking out the product; D) preparing a solution from tea polyphenols, chitosan and water, putting the cocoon stripping nonwoven fabric treated in the step C) into the solution to soak, taking out the cocoon stripping nonwoven fabric and then drying the cocoon stripping nonwoven fabric so as to obtain the natural silk functional textile. The method disclosed by the invention has the beneficial effects that 1) the preparation method is simple; 2) the elapsed time is drastically reduced; 3) tea polyphenols have an inhibition effect and antimicrobial and bactericidal effects on cancer cells, and chitosan has a good antibacterial effect; 4) a molecule network-like structure is formed on the surface of the functional textile, and achieves a protective effect on the textile.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a new preparation method of silk functional textiles, belonging to the technical field of preparation methods of textiles. Background technique [0002] Functional fibers and functional textiles are fiber materials and textile products that represent the level of technological development in materials, chemicals, textiles and related fields. The development of functional textiles, which integrates comfort, leisure and health care, has become the trend of textile development in the world today. It can keep the human body in a comfortable state all the time, which has positive significance for the development of functional clothing and fabrics. Cocoon non-woven fabric is a natural protein with a unique molecular structure, good biocompatibility with the human body, and many irreplaceable advantages of other materials.
